Phil Posted November 18, 2019 Author Share Posted November 18, 2019 Credit is owed the Rangers for treating Lias Andersson as they would any other young prospect required to earn minutes and not as an entitled seventh-overall selection of the 2017 entry draft that the Swede was just hours after the club had obtained that pick in the Derek Stepan deal with Arizona. Credit to the front office led first by Glen Sather and now by John Davidson for not directing David Quinn to abandon his principles and give the youngster ice time the coach did not believe Andersson had warranted in order to make what appears an unwise draft decision look good. ?We?re open to everything,? Quinn said when asked about shifting Andersson to the flank, where he lined up 10 times for the Rangers last season. ?I think moving Lias to wing is an option, too. ?I think if he plays well, there?s an opportunity on the wing. I think everything is on the table for him if he goes down there and plays well and if we bring him up, maybe we do put him on the wing. But at his age I want to continue to give him a fair opportunity in the middle.? https://nypost.com/2019/11/18/everything-is-on-the-table-for-rangers-when-it-comes-to-lias-andersson/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
